Описание
The ATtiny2313 is a low-power CMOS 8-bit microcontroller based on the AVR enhanced RISC architecture. By executing powerful instructions in a single clock cycle, the ATtiny2313 achieves throughputs approaching 1 MIPS per MHz allowing the system designer to optimize power consumption versus processing speed.
- Utilizes the AVR® RISC Architecture
- AVR
- High-performance and Low-power RISC Architecture
- 120 Powerful Instructions
- Most Single Clock Cycle Execution
- 32 x 8 General Purpose Working Registers
- Fully Static Operation
- Up to 20 MIPS Throughput at 20 MHz
- Data and Non-volatile Program and Data Memories
- 2K Bytes of In-System Self Programmable Flash Endurance 10,000 Write/Erase Cycles
- 128 Bytes In-System Programmable EEPROM Endurance: 100,000 Write/Erase Cycles
- 128 Bytes Internal SRAM
- Programming Lock for Flash Program and EEPROM Data Security
- Peripheral Features
- One 8-bit Timer/Counter with Separate Prescaler and Compare Mode
- One 16-bit Timer/Counter with Separate Prescaler, Compare and Capture Modes
- Four PWM Channels
- On-chip Analog Comparator
- Programmable Watchdog Timer with On-chip Oscillator
- USI
- Universal Serial Interface
- Full Duplex USART
- Special Microcontroller Features
- debug WIRE On-chip Debugging
- In-System Programmable via SPI Port
- External and Internal Interrupt Sources
- Low-power Idle, Power-down, and Standby Modes
- Enhanced Power-on Reset Circuit
- Programmable Brown-out Detection Circuit
- Internal Calibrated Oscillator
- I/O and Packages
- 18 Programmable I/O Lines
- 20-pin PDIP, 20-pin SOIC, 20-pad QFN/MLF
- Operating Voltages
- 1.8
- 5.5V (ATtiny2313V)
- 2.7
- 5.5V (ATtiny2313)
- Speed Grades
- ATtiny2313V: 0
- 4 MHz @ 1.8 – 5.5V, 0
- 10 MHz @ 2.7
- 5.5V
- ATtiny2313: 0
- 10 MHz @ 2.7 – 5.5V, 0
- 20 MHz @ 4.5
- 5.5V
- Typical Power Consumption
- Active Mode 1 MHz, 1.8V: 230 µA 32 kHz, 1.8V: 20 µA (including oscillator)
- Power-down Mode < 0.1 µA at 1.8V